What it is AI-extracted, prompt v1, taxonomy v1, 2026-08-29, confidence not recorded

Maybe is a self-hostable personal finance web app built with Ruby on Rails and Hotwire for tracking accounts, budgets, and net worth. The repository is no longer actively maintained, though it remains forkable under AGPLv3.

Use cases

  • self-host a personal finance tracker
  • track net worth and accounts privately
  • manage household budgets on my own server
  • find an open-source Mint alternative
  • fork an unmaintained finance app to continue development

When to choose

  • you want a full-featured, self-hosted personal finance app with Docker deployment
  • you want to fork and maintain your own finance app under AGPLv3

When to avoid

  • you need active maintenance, security patches, or community support
  • you want a hosted or mobile-first finance app
  • you cannot accept AGPLv3 licensing constraints
